Question 1177799: A video camera is placed on a 120 m tall building. The angle of depression from the camera to the base of another building is 36o. The angle of elevation from the camera to the top of the same building is 47o.
How far apart are the two buildings? Round your answer to the nearest meter. Show work.
How tall is the building viewed by the camera? Round your answer to the nearest meter. Show work.

tan 36 = 120/AB
AB = 120/tan 36
AB =165 m
tan 47 = x/ 165
x= 165 * tan 47 =177
Height of building = 120+177= 297 m
